🟥 2: U.S. Legal Action Against Cuba (Raúl Castro Case)
-
Potential historic indictment:
The U.S. Department of Justice is expected to announce criminal charges against former Cuban leader Raúl Castro. -
Incident at the center (1996 shootdown):
The case relates to the shootdown of two civilian planes by Cuba in 1996, killing four people from a Miami-based group aiding refugees. -
Long-delayed justice:
The move is accountability after nearly 30 years, especially for Cuban exile families. -
High-level U.S. involvement:
Senior officials (DOJ, FBI, political leaders) are expected at the announcement, signaling major national significance. -
